In Dota 2 7.41e, Huskar and Outworld Destroyer win 47.66% of ranked matches when playing on the same team, over 214 matches.
Thinking you can save a low-health Huskar with Astral Imprisonment is where drafts with these two go wrong. In reality, you're often pulling Huskar out of the fight right when his attack speed is highest, giving the enemy a crucial window to reposition or escape. This fundamental conflict extends to their overall game plan. Huskar is built to create an overwhelming mid-game tempo that forces objectives. Outworld Destroyer, on the other hand, needs more time and space to scale into a late-game threat. They end up wanting to play the game at two different speeds.
